RULE §349.335Commencement of Disciplinary Proceedings

(a) If a disciplinary matter is not resolved informally, the Commission may commence disciplinary proceedings by filing formal charges.

(b) The formal charges shall contain the following information:

  (1) the name of the Certified Officer and his or her certification number;

  (2) a statement alleging with reasonable certainty the specific act or acts relied upon by the Commission to constitute a violation of a specific statute or Commission rule; and

  (3) a reference to the section of the Commission rules that the Certified Officer is alleged to have violated.

(c) When formal charges are filed, the Commission shall serve the Certified Officer with a copy of the formal charges. The notice shall state that the Certified Officer shall file a written answer to the formal charges that meets the requirements of §349.340 and §349.370 of this chapter.

(d) The Commission may amend the formal charges at any time as permitted by the Texas Administrative Procedure Act, Chapter 2001 of the Texas Government Code Annotated. A copy of any formal amended charges shall be served on the Certified Officer.

(e) Formal charges may be resolved by agreement of the parties at any time as provided by the Texas Administrative Procedure Act, Chapter 2001 of the Texas Government Code Annotated.
